The Importance of a Set of 3 Spirit Levels in Construction In the realm of construction and home improvement, precision is paramount. Achieving accurate measurements can be the difference between a well-constructed structure and a disjointed mess. One of the most indispensable tools for ensuring this precision is the spirit level, particularly when it comes to using a set of three spirit levels. The Importance of a Set of 3 Spirit Levels in Construction The first tool in a set of three is typically a standard level, which is used for horizontal and vertical alignments. This level is crucial for tasks such as hanging pictures, installing cabinets, and aligning furniture. It ensures that the work is aesthetically pleasing and functional, as misalignment can lead to improper functioning and elevated wear on materials over time. set of 3 spirit levels The second level in the set is often referred to as a torpedo level, which is shorter and designed for use in tight spaces. Its compact size allows it to fit into places where a standard level cannot, such as between studs or in small corners. The torpedo level is an essential tool for tasks that require pinpoint precision in confined areas, such as when installing light fixtures or shelving brackets. The third level in the set is typically a line level, which is used for checking long distances. Often used in landscaping or excavation work, a line level is suspended on a string or line. This enables builders to ensure that an entire stretch (like a fence line or a pathway) is level over a significant distance. By utilizing a line level, construction professionals can avoid inconsistencies that might arise over extended spans. In conclusion, a set of three spirit levels—comprising a standard level, a torpedo level, and a line level—provides a comprehensive toolkit for ensuring precision in various construction tasks. Each type of level serves a specific function and, when used together, they offer versatility and accuracy. For both professionals and DIY enthusiasts, investing in a set of three spirit levels is not just a smart choice—it is an essential step toward achieving high-quality, precise outcomes in construction and home improvement endeavors.

Understanding the Meter Spirit Level A Tool for Precision in Construction The meter spirit level, an indispensable tool in construction, carpentry, and DIY projects, is designed to determine whether a surface is perfectly horizontal or vertical. This simple yet ingenious device has evolved over centuries, embodying the blend of craftsmanship and engineering, and continues to be a cornerstone in various fields where accuracy is paramount. At its core, a spirit level utilizes the principles of gravity and liquid movement to provide readings that inform users of the evenness of surfaces. Traditionally, this tool is constructed of a long, straight body—often made from wood, aluminum, or plastic—with one or more vials containing a liquid (usually alcohol) and an air bubble. The gauges are calibrated to indicate the precise position of the bubble relative to marked lines, which signify level (horizontal) or plumb (vertical) orientations. The meter spirit level gets its name partly from its standard measurement in meters, allowing users to work with long surfaces or large distances effectively. While small levels are useful for minor tasks, the meter-long versions are particularly advantageous for larger installations, such as when leveling drywall, flooring, or large furniture. One of the most significant advantages of using a meter spirit level is its ease of use. Whether you are a professional contractor or a weekend DIY enthusiast, aligning a level is a straightforward process. You simply place the level on the surface, observe the position of the bubble, and adjust the surface accordingly until the bubble sits centered between the markings . This simplicity makes it accessible for beginners while still being precise enough for seasoned professionals. meter spirit level In addition to its basic function, modern spirit levels feature enhancements such as magnetic strips for easy attachment to metal surfaces, built-in measurement tools, and laser levels that project a line for additional guidance. These innovations cater to the evolving demands of construction and design, allowing users to maintain accuracy even in complex projects. The importance of a properly leveled surface cannot be overstated. An unlevel structure can lead to a variety of problems, from minor cosmetic issues, such as misaligned furniture, to significant structural failures. In time, an unlevel floor can crack, walls can bow, and doors may not function properly. Consequently, reliable leveling tools like the meter spirit level are vital for both aesthetic and functional integrity in construction. Additionally, the meter spirit level is not limited to traditional construction fields. It has also found relevance in various niche areas, such as photography and art. Artists and photographers often use spirit levels to ensure their work is aligned precisely, resulting in balanced compositions that enhance the viewer's experience. In conclusion, the meter spirit level is a crucial tool that merges simplicity and accuracy, making it a staple for professionals and amateurs alike. Its importance in ensuring level surfaces cannot be overstated, as it has wide-reaching implications for aesthetic appeal and structural integrity. As construction technology continues to advance, the spirit level remains a fundamental component that underscores the importance of precision in building and design. Despite the emergence of advanced leveling instruments, the meter spirit level stands resilient as a trusted tool symbolizing craftsmanship and careful execution. Whether you are leveling a shelf, laying tiles, or constructing a home, the meter spirit level is sure to be your reliable partner, guiding you toward achieving the perfect balance in your projects.
